- All global health online majors are strongly encouraged to go on a summer study abroad program to fulfill major requirements. The 6 hours in term Term 5 - A reflect the six hours that must be completed abroad, or with 2 additional Global Health core courses through the School of Human Evolution and Social Change. Please contact your academic advisor for travel dates and options, or to inquire about petitioning for a substitution.
